April 16---6pm

In this hands-on and demonstrative cooking class, participants will learn how to make stunning sourdough bread. Led by CIA trained chef Chelsea Bruce and owner of North Fork Chai Co, in this class we will share our starter, the steps to feed and use it to create two stunning breads. Basic country loaf and Roasted Garlic. Each student will make their own dough in class to take home for an overnight rise that can be baked the following day. Snacks will be provided. This class is expected to run longer than others to 3-3 1/2 hours
